This variation of the No Jive 3-in-1 was available through yoyoguy.com (Infinite Illusions) in the mid-2000s. This example featured the same take-apart construction common to all No Jives, with the Infinite Illusions 'Two Girls' graphic stamped on one half. The reverse half has a standard "No Jive Special" stamp, indicating that it is a special release. This is a rare painted No Jive that was released in butterfly shape. The painted finish adds a bit of heft, making it subtly different from other No Jives.

There is also a run of 50 in black of this yo-yo.
